I'm trying to acquire names from a database table and insert them into into boxes in a form which in turn will insert them into another database table. Thus far I get them into the input box but when I click the submit, I get an error:Query failed: Column count doesn't match value count at row 1. Does this mean it is neccesarily a PHP problem? I know that the table jives with the code and having never used Ajax I just don't know.
include 'prerentget.php';
?> [/PHP
HTML Code:
    <style type="text/css">
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
    <script type="text/javascript">
        function getResults() {
            var search_val = $("#apt").val();
            $.post("test.php", { search_term: search_val }, function(data) {
                if (data.length > 0) {
                    $("#tname")[0].value = data;

<body onload="document.form.apt.focus()">
<form name=form action="testinsert.php" method="post">
<input type="text" size="2" name="apt" id="apt" onkeyup="getResults();
"if(this.value.length==this.size)document.form.time.focus();" />Apt<br />
<input type="text" size="25" id="tname" />Name<br />

<INPUT TYPE="text" size=10 name=datereceived  
onKeyUp="if(this.value.length==this.size)document.form.time.focus();">Date Received<BR>
<INPUT TYPE="text" size=7 name=time>Time Received<BR> 
<INPUT TYPE="text" size=100 name=symptom>Problem<BR> 
<INPUT TYPE="text" size=100 name=action>Action<BR>
<INPUT TYPE="text" size=2 name=compmo MAXLENGTH=2  

<INPUT TYPE="text" size=2 name=compday MAXLENGTH=2  
<INPUT TYPE="text" size=4 name=compyear MAXLENGTH=4  
onKeyUp="if(this.value.length==this.size)document.form.ordno.focus();">Date Completed<br>
<INPUT TYPE="text" size=4 name=ordno>Order# -  If Insp<p> 
<INPUT type=submit value="submit data"/> 

